PLANNING AND DEVELOPMENT ACT 2005 - SECT 18

18 .         Minister to have access to information

        (1)         The Minister is entitled —

            (a)         to have information in the possession of the Commission; and

            (b)         if the information is in or on a document, to have, and make and retain copies of, that document.

        (2)         For the purposes of subsection (1) the Minister may —

            (a)         request the Commission to give information to the Minister; and

            (b)         request the Commission to give the Minister access to information; and

            (c)         for the purposes of paragraph (b) make use of the staff of the Commission to obtain the information and give it to the Minister.

        (3)         The Commission has to comply with a request under subsection (2) and make its staff and facilities available to the Minister for the purposes of paragraph (c) of that subsection.

        (4)         In this section —

        document includes any tape, disc or other device or medium on which information is recorded or stored mechanically, photographically, electronically or otherwise;

        information means information specified, or of a description specified, by the Minister that relates to the functions of the Commission.
